Home
last modified time | relevance | path

Searched refs:_PAGE_EXEC (Results 1 – 25 of 30) sorted by relevance

12

/arch/powerpc/include/asm/
Dpte-common.h16 #ifndef _PAGE_EXEC
17 #define _PAGE_EXEC 0 macro
59 #define _PAGE_KERNEL_ROX (_PAGE_EXEC | _PAGE_RO)
65 #define _PAGE_KERNEL_RWX (_PAGE_DIRTY | _PAGE_RW | _PAGE_HWWRITE | _PAGE_EXEC)
118 _PAGE_RW | _PAGE_HWWRITE | _PAGE_DIRTY | _PAGE_EXEC)
147 _PAGE_EXEC)
150 _PAGE_EXEC)
153 _PAGE_EXEC)
/arch/powerpc/include/asm/nohash/32/
Dpte-8xx.h42 #define _PAGE_EXEC 0x0040 /* Copied to L1 APG */ macro
58 #define _PAGE_KERNEL_ROX (_PAGE_SHARED | _PAGE_RO | _PAGE_EXEC)
62 _PAGE_HWWRITE | _PAGE_EXEC)
Dpte-44x.h76 #define _PAGE_EXEC 0x00000004 /* H: Execute permission */ macro
Dpte-fsl-booke.h23 #define _PAGE_EXEC 0x00010 /* H: SX permission */ macro
Dpte-40x.h49 #define _PAGE_EXEC 0x200 /* hardware: EX permission */ macro
Dpgtable.h192 if ((old & _PAGE_USER) && (old & _PAGE_EXEC)) in pte_update()
223 if ((old & _PAGE_USER) && (old & _PAGE_EXEC)) in pte_update()
274 (_PAGE_DIRTY | _PAGE_ACCESSED | _PAGE_RW | _PAGE_EXEC); in __ptep_set_access_flags()
/arch/openrisc/include/asm/
Dpgtable.h137 #define _PAGE_EXEC 0x400 /* software: page is executable */ macro
164 #define PAGE_READONLY_X __pgprot(_PAGE_ALL | _PAGE_URE | _PAGE_SRE | _PAGE_EXEC)
170 | _PAGE_SHARED | _PAGE_EXEC)
172 #define PAGE_COPY_X __pgprot(_PAGE_ALL | _PAGE_URE | _PAGE_SRE | _PAGE_EXEC)
176 | _PAGE_SHARED | _PAGE_DIRTY | _PAGE_EXEC)
179 | _PAGE_SHARED | _PAGE_DIRTY | _PAGE_EXEC)
182 | _PAGE_SHARED | _PAGE_DIRTY | _PAGE_EXEC | _PAGE_CI)
239 static inline int pte_exec(pte_t pte) { return pte_val(pte) & _PAGE_EXEC; } in pte_exec()
259 pte_val(pte) &= ~(_PAGE_EXEC); in pte_exprotect()
289 pte_val(pte) |= _PAGE_EXEC; in pte_mkexec()
/arch/powerpc/mm/
Dpgtable.c75 #if defined(CONFIG_PPC_STD_MMU) || _PAGE_EXEC == 0
119 if (!(pte_val(pte) & _PAGE_EXEC) || !pte_looks_normal(pte)) in set_pte_filter()
139 return __pte(pte_val(pte) & ~_PAGE_EXEC); in set_pte_filter()
152 if (dirty || (pte_val(pte) & _PAGE_EXEC) || !is_exec_fault()) in set_access_flags_filter()
178 return __pte(pte_val(pte) | _PAGE_EXEC); in set_access_flags_filter()
D40x_mmu.c110 unsigned long val = p | _PMD_SIZE_16M | _PAGE_EXEC | _PAGE_HWWRITE; in mmu_mapin_ram()
125 unsigned long val = p | _PMD_SIZE_4M | _PAGE_EXEC | _PAGE_HWWRITE; in mmu_mapin_ram()
Dtlb_low_64e.S231 andi. r10,r11,_PAGE_EXEC|_PAGE_BAP_SX
251 li r11,_PAGE_PRESENT|_PAGE_EXEC /* Base perm */
634 li r11,_PAGE_PRESENT|_PAGE_EXEC /* Base perm */
771 andi. r10,r11,_PAGE_EXEC
Dpgtable_64.c239 flags &= ~_PAGE_EXEC; in ioremap_prot()
/arch/microblaze/include/asm/
Dpgtable.h231 #ifndef _PAGE_EXEC
232 #define _PAGE_EXEC 0 macro
253 #define PAGE_READONLY_X __pgprot(_PAGE_BASE | _PAGE_USER | _PAGE_EXEC)
256 __pgprot(_PAGE_BASE | _PAGE_USER | _PAGE_RW | _PAGE_EXEC)
258 #define PAGE_COPY_X __pgprot(_PAGE_BASE | _PAGE_USER | _PAGE_EXEC)
334 static inline int pte_exec(pte_t pte) { return pte_val(pte) & _PAGE_EXEC; } in pte_exec()
346 { pte_val(pte) &= ~_PAGE_EXEC; return pte; } in pte_exprotect()
355 { pte_val(pte) |= _PAGE_USER | _PAGE_EXEC; return pte; } in pte_mkexec()
/arch/m32r/include/asm/
Dpgtable.h97 #define _PAGE_EXEC (1UL << _PAGE_BIT_EXEC) macro
119 __pgprot(_PAGE_PRESENT | _PAGE_EXEC | _PAGE_WRITE | _PAGE_READ \
124 __pgprot(_PAGE_PRESENT | _PAGE_EXEC | _PAGE_READ | _PAGE_ACCESSED)
128 __pgprot(_PAGE_PRESENT | _PAGE_EXEC | _PAGE_READ | _PAGE_ACCESSED)
131 ( _PAGE_PRESENT | _PAGE_EXEC | _PAGE_WRITE | _PAGE_READ | _PAGE_DIRTY \
/arch/nios2/include/asm/
Dpgtable-bits.h21 #define _PAGE_EXEC (1<<21) macro
Dpgtable.h36 ((x) ? _PAGE_EXEC : 0) | \
66 _PAGE_WRITE | _PAGE_EXEC | _PAGE_GLOBAL)
180 const unsigned long mask = _PAGE_READ | _PAGE_WRITE | _PAGE_EXEC; in pte_modify()
/arch/powerpc/include/asm/nohash/
Dpte-book3e.h50 #define _PAGE_EXEC _PAGE_BAP_UX /* .. and was cache cleaned */ macro
/arch/powerpc/include/asm/book3s/64/
Dpgtable.h11 #define _PAGE_EXEC 0x00001 /* execute permission */ macro
15 #define _PAGE_RWX (_PAGE_READ | _PAGE_WRITE | _PAGE_EXEC)
63 _PAGE_RW | _PAGE_EXEC)
80 _PAGE_READ | _PAGE_WRITE | _PAGE_DIRTY | _PAGE_EXEC | \
103 #define PAGE_SHARED_X __pgprot(_PAGE_BASE | _PAGE_RW | _PAGE_EXEC)
105 #define PAGE_COPY_X __pgprot(_PAGE_BASE | _PAGE_READ | _PAGE_EXEC)
107 #define PAGE_READONLY_X __pgprot(_PAGE_BASE | _PAGE_READ | _PAGE_EXEC)
Dhash.h143 _PAGE_EXEC | _PAGE_SOFT_DIRTY); in hash__ptep_set_access_flags()
Dradix.h174 _PAGE_RW | _PAGE_EXEC); in radix__ptep_set_access_flags()
/arch/parisc/include/asm/
Dpgtable.h193 #define _PAGE_EXEC (1 << xlate_pabit(_PAGE_EXEC_BIT)) macro
207 #define _PAGE_KERNEL_EXEC (_PAGE_KERNEL_RO | _PAGE_EXEC)
236 #define PAGE_EXECREAD __pgprot(_PAGE_PRESENT | _PAGE_USER | _PAGE_READ | _PAGE_EXEC |_PAGE_ACCESS…
238 #define PAGE_RWX __pgprot(_PAGE_PRESENT | _PAGE_USER | _PAGE_READ | _PAGE_WRITE | _PAGE_EXEC
/arch/powerpc/sysdev/
Dppc4xx_ocm.c182 ioflags = _PAGE_NO_CACHE | _PAGE_GUARDED | _PAGE_EXEC; in ocm_init_node()
198 ioflags = _PAGE_EXEC; in ocm_init_node()
/arch/openrisc/mm/
Dfault.c157 if ((vector == 0x400) && !(vma->vm_page_prot.pgprot & _PAGE_EXEC)) in do_page_fault()
/arch/nios2/mm/
Dtlb.c189 (tlbacc & _PAGE_EXEC ? 'x' : '-'), in dump_tlb_line()
/arch/powerpc/include/asm/nohash/64/
Dpgtable.h307 (_PAGE_DIRTY | _PAGE_ACCESSED | _PAGE_RW | _PAGE_EXEC); in __ptep_set_access_flags()
/arch/powerpc/kernel/
Dhead_fsl_booke.S569 li r13,_PAGE_PRESENT | _PAGE_ACCESSED | _PAGE_EXEC
583 li r13,_PAGE_PRESENT | _PAGE_ACCESSED | _PAGE_EXEC
772 li r10, (_PAGE_EXEC | _PAGE_PRESENT)

12